Cheapest Available Curtis Park 1 Bedroom Apartments

Currently the lowest priced 1 Bedroom apartment unit Curtis Park of Denver, CO is the 1 Bedroom Model starting from $1,025 at Grant Place. The average price for all 1 Bedroom apartments in Curtis Park is currently $2,218. Here is today’s list of the cheapest available 1 Bedroom options in the area:

Frequently Asked Questions about 1 Bedroom Curtis Park Apartments

What is the Cheapest apartment in Curtis Park with 1 Bedroom?

Currently the most affordable 1 Bedroom in Curtis Park is at Grant Place listed at $1,025.

How much is the average rent for a 1 Bedroom Curtis Park Apartment?

The average rent for a 1 Bedroom Apartment in Curtis Park is $2,218.

What is the largest available 1 Bedroom Curtis Park Apartment for rent?

Today's apartment with the most square footage in Curtis Park is a 1,349 square feet unit starting from $5,865 at Flora RiNo.

What is the average size for Curtis Park 1 Bedroom Apartments for rent?

The average size for a 1 Bedroom rental in Curtis Park is currently 799 sq ft.
